i dont think Islam will ever truly surpass Khabib since Khabib was the first one out of Dagestan to really get super famous. he had so many iconic lines and phrases. he also went undefeated in the UFC and didnt have much trouble with most opponents.
Islam has proven to be extremely skilled and dangerous, but he's been KO'd before and some opponents have given him some trouble like Arman, Thiago Moises and Volk. its likely he surpasses Khabib in title defenses and/or if he wins a second belt. but i dont think he will ever have the same impact Khabib had on the sport.
